The Accutron 2624 is a classic vintage electronic watch from Bulova’s legendary Accutron collection, powered by the renowned tuning-fork movement that revolutionized timekeeping accuracy. Produced in the late 1960s, this elegant model showcases Bulova’s innovative engineering and remains a desirable collectible among vintage watch enthusiasts.

About the Brand
Accutron: Introduced in 1960 by Bulova, Accutron revolutionized watchmaking with the world’s first tuning fork electronic movement. Offering unprecedented accuracy, Accutron-powered watches were worn by state officials and astronauts alike, and the technology was used by NASA in spacecraft instrumentation. Acquired by the Citizen Group in 2008, the brand continues today, though its greatest appeal lies in its remarkable collection of vintage timepieces.
